Warning Signs You Need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Are you experiencing musty odors in your home that won’t go away? This could be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age. Our team is here to help you identify the source of the issue and repair or replace your refrigerator water line.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ky water line. Don’t ignore these signs; our team is available 24/7 to respond to your emergency and prevent further damage.

Swollen or Warped Flooring

Swollen or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age or a leaky water line. Our team will assess the situation and take the necessary steps to repair or replace the damaged parts.

Discoloration or Warping of Drywall

Discoloration or warping of drywall can be a sign of water damage or a leaky water line. Our team will inspect the area and take the necessary steps to repair or replace the damaged parts.

High Water Bills

Are your water bills higher than usual? This could be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age. Our team is here to help you identify the source of the issue and repair or replace your refrigerator water line.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al Cost in Florence, AZ

The cost of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al in Florence,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a breakdown of the typical price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Leak Detection $500 – $2,500 Severity of leak, size of affected area, local conditions.
Repair or Replacement of Damaged Parts $1,000 – $5,000 Complexity of repair or replacement, quality of materials used, labor costs.
Drying and Sanitizing of Affected Area $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used, labor costs.
Final Inspection and Verification $200 – $1,000 Complexity of inspection, type of materials used, labor costs.
More Expenses (e.g., permits, inspections) $500 – $2,000 Local regulations, inspector fees, permit costs.

The final cost of your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al service will depend on the specifics of your situation and the services required. Our team will provide you with a clear, upfront estimate and help you navigate the process.
